There should be a "Corsair Composite Virtual Input Device" listed under your device manager, but it's not in your photos. Try running the repair tool in the CUE Uninstaller, and this should resolve the issue. Also, make sure all the Windows updates have been performed.

Try manually installing the Corsair Bus drivers via Device Manager. It can be found in the install folder under drivers/hid.

e.g.

C:\Program Files (x86)\Corsair\Corsair Utility Engine\driver\hid

 

The virtual driver is also located in that folder as well.

Don't know if you found a fix yet, but here is what worked for me.

 

The problem I had was everytime I launched a game in fullscreen, the side buttons on my m65 pro rgb wouldn't register. So what I did to try and fix it is make a custom profile for Overwatch and make that profile active when the game is turned on. Huzzah! It somehow fixed all the problems I had with my mouse.
